About this author

National Bestselling author J.D. Tyler is best known for her dark, sexy paranormal series Alpha Pack, and the Firefighters of Station Five series under her pseudonym Jo Davis. She's been a multiple finalist in the Colorado Romance Writers Award of Excellence, a finalist for the Bookseller's Best Award, has captured the HOLT Medallion Award of Merit, and has been two-time nominee for the Australian Romance Readers Award in romantic suspense. PRIMAL LAW, the first book in her Alpha Pack series, was recently named a finalist for the National Reader’s Choice Award in Paranormal.
